SendToMac

A cross-platform application that lets users transfer text and links from iOS to macOS, even if the Mac is offline. Built with Python, AppKit, Rumps, SwiftUI, it features real-time notifications, scheduling/expiration logic, and secure REST API communication for reliable and seamless cross-device workflows.

Chess

An interactive web application that enforces all chess rules, including check, checkmate, stalemate, and legal move validation. Designed with HTML, CSS, and JavaScript, it features modular move logic, real-time piece interaction, and a responsive UI for smooth and accurate gameplay.

GreenMindAI

HackMIT

An eco-conscious AI chatbot that routes queries through three models (TinyLlama, Hugging Face, Claude) based on carbon emissions. The system prioritizes the most sustainable model first, falling back to more powerful options only when necessary, using token count and CodeCarbon metrics to minimize environmental impact.
